hi there. i recently purchased a hercules 4mx and im having some problems with the sound. and i was wondering if you guys could help. when i play my music through virtual dj pro 7 i can hear almost like a compressor working really hard. its similiar to a bad youtube recording, the volume willl go and up and down depending on how much information is in the song.

i mix drum and bass and i can really notice this. its almost like the high and low frequencies wont play at the same time, high frequences dulled down considerably when low are trying to play and sometimes vice versa. besides my issues with sound the unit itself is very responsive eispecially with vdj7 and there are no problems with lag or anything like that.

im running on windows with a dual 1.73ghz proc. and 2gigs of ram. ive also re-installed hercules drivers and restored factory settings on vdj7. at present im getting better sound on my hercules mk4 which is a shame considering the price difference. any advice on how i could resolve the issue would be much appreciated. thx.

-------

in addition, ive found out i cant seem to play the 4 mx in asio mode with vdj7. if vdj7 is closed and i set it to asio in hercules control panel, it jus changes to back wdm as soon as i open vdj7. if i try and change it from wdm to asio in vdj7 it just blocks. i dont know if this might have anything to do with it and the sound issues ive been getting.

hello koz,

1) as dj console 4-mx output level is very strong, you may have to change the output level on the 4-mx control panel (the hercules software panel, where you can set the output 1-2 and 3-4: dj console 4-mx output can go up to +8dbu, so it may saturate your speakers).

3)  virtualdj 7 automatically sets dj console 4-mx
- in asio if you set inputs = line-ins 
- in wdm if you set inputs = none 
that is why you cannot set it in another way (in previous version of virtualdj pro, there was no line in setting in dj console series, that is one of the changes in virtualdj 7).

actually komart, the control panel allows you to select the input level according to which device you want to use.

the output level of the mk4 is standard line level -10 dbv, wether you use the rca of minijack connector.
